Granite stain removal is defined as the process of extracting absorbed substances from granite’s porous surface using stain-specific chemical agents. Knowing how to remove stains from granite correctly matters because granite is porous, and stain removal is a chemistry problem, not just surface cleaning. The wrong product can set a stain deeper or cause permanent surface damage. The professional poultice method is the industry standard for deep stain extraction, and it works by drawing absorbed material out of granite’s pores through controlled evaporation. This guide covers stain identification, the poultice technique, daily maintenance, and when to call a professional.

What is the professional poultice method for deep stain removal?

The poultice method is the professional standard for removing deep, set-in stains from granite. It uses a paste of absorbent powder and a stain-specific chemical agent to draw the absorbed substance back out of the stone’s pores. Physical scrubbing cannot reach deep stains. The poultice does the work through chemistry and controlled evaporation.

Choosing the right ingredients

The absorbent base is typically diatomaceous earth, kaolin clay, or unbleached flour. The chemical agent must match the stain type. Alkaline degreasers work for oil-based stains, hydrogen peroxide addresses organic and biological stains, and reducing agents handle rust. Using the wrong agent can fail or worsen stain extraction. Mix the powder and chemical agent to a peanut butter consistency. The paste should be thick enough to hold its shape without running.

Step-by-step application

  1. Clean the surface. Wipe the stained area with warm water and a soft cloth to remove surface debris. Let it dry completely.
  2. Apply the poultice. Spread the paste over the stain at least 1/4 inch thick, extending about 1 inch beyond the stain’s edges.
  3. Cover with plastic wrap. Tape the edges down with painter’s tape to seal the poultice against the stone.
  4. Puncture the plastic. Make small holes in the plastic wrap to allow slow, controlled evaporation. This is the key step. Controlled evaporation through small holes creates capillary action that pulls the stain out of the pores.
  5. Wait 24–48 hours. Do not disturb the poultice. Removing it early reduces extraction power significantly.
  6. Remove the poultice. Once fully dry, lift the plastic and scrape the dried paste away gently with a plastic scraper. Never use metal tools.
  7. Rinse and assess. Wipe the area with clean water and a soft cloth. Let it dry fully before evaluating the result.

Pro Tip: If the poultice is still damp after 24 hours, leave it in place. The drying process is the extraction mechanism. Removing it wet stops the process before it finishes.

The table below shows the correct chemical agent for each stain type:

Stain type Chemical agent
Oil-based (grease, cooking oil) Alkaline degreaser
Organic (coffee, wine, food) Hydrogen peroxide (12%)
Rust or metal Reducing agent (rust remover)
Biological (mold, mildew) Diluted hydrogen peroxide
Ink or dye Acetone or mineral spirits

Some deep or old stains need up to five poultice cycles. Patience is not optional here. Early removal of the plastic reduces stain extraction power and extends the total treatment time.

What daily cleaning practices protect granite from staining?

Routine care is the most effective way to prevent stains from forming in the first place. Granite’s porous structure means that spills left on the surface for even a short time can begin to penetrate. A consistent daily routine protects both the stone and its sealer.

Only warm water and a pH-neutral stone cleaner or mild dish soap are recommended for daily granite maintenance. pH-neutral cleaners do not react with the stone’s minerals or break down the sealer. This preserves the surface’s protective barrier and its polished appearance.

Wipe spills immediately using a soft cloth or paper towel. Blot rather than wipe outward. Wiping spreads the liquid and increases the surface area that can absorb it. For sticky residue, dampen a cloth with warm water and let it sit on the spot for 30 seconds before blotting.

Daily cleaning with mild, pH-neutral cleaners preserves granite sealers and prevents stain penetration, extending the surface’s life. Sealer integrity is the single most important factor in stain prevention. A properly sealed granite surface resists most common household stains. Pro Tip: Test your granite’s sealer by placing a few drops of water on the surface. If the water beads up, the sealer is intact. If it absorbs within a few minutes, the surface needs resealing.

How do you troubleshoot common mistakes in granite stain removal?

The most common mistake homeowners make is treating etching as a stain. Etching is irreversible surface chemical damage caused by acids that dulls granite’s polished look. No amount of cleaning removes it. Professional re-polishing is the only solution. If you see a dull, matte patch where a lemon or vinegar spill occurred, stop cleaning and contact a stone care professional.

Persistent stains that show no improvement after two poultice applications signal the need for professional intervention. Further DIY attempts risk damaging the granite finish and can worsen conditions permanently. Knowing when to stop is as important as knowing how to start.

What working with granite has taught me about patience and prevention

The single biggest mistake I see homeowners make is reaching for the nearest household cleaner the moment a stain appears. Granite looks tough. It is tough. But its porous structure means that the wrong cleaner can cause more damage in 60 seconds than the original spill did in an hour.

The poultice method feels slow because it is slow. That is the point. The chemistry needs time to work, and the evaporation process needs to complete fully. Homeowners who lift the plastic after 12 hours and see no change assume the method failed. It did not fail. It was interrupted. I have seen stains that looked permanent come out completely after a third poultice cycle applied with full patience.

Prevention, though, is where the real value is. A well-sealed granite surface is dramatically easier to maintain. Most of the stain calls I see involve surfaces that have not been professionally sealed in years. The sealer is the first line of defense, and when it fails, the stone absorbs everything. Protecting natural stone from stains starts with the sealer, not the cleaning routine.

Old, deep stains are a different situation. If a stain has been sitting in granite for months, two poultice cycles may not be enough. That is not a failure of the method. It is a signal that the stone needs professional attention. Managing that expectation early saves homeowners from damaging their surfaces with repeated aggressive attempts.

FAQ

What is the best method for removing deep stains from granite?

The poultice method is the professional standard for deep stain removal. It uses an absorbent paste mixed with a stain-specific chemical agent, applied under plastic wrap for 24–48 hours to draw the stain out of the stone’s pores.

Can I use vinegar to clean stains from granite?

Vinegar is acidic and causes immediate etching on granite surfaces. Use only pH-neutral stone cleaners or mild dish soap with warm water for safe daily cleaning.

What is the difference between a stain and etching on granite?

A stain is an absorbed substance inside the stone’s pores. Etching is surface chemical damage from acids that dulls the polished finish. Etching cannot be cleaned away and requires professional re-polishing.

How many times should I apply a poultice before calling a professional?

Apply the poultice no more than twice. If no improvement appears after two full cycles, further DIY treatment risks permanent damage to the granite finish and professional care is needed.

How do I prevent stains on granite countertops?

Wipe spills immediately, use only pH-neutral cleaners, and maintain a quality sealer. Professional resealing every one to three years keeps the stone’s protective barrier intact and prevents most common household stains from penetrating.
